Rayna Freedman— Dr. Rayna Freedman is a fifth-grade teacher at Jordan/Jackson Elementary in Mansfield, MA, with over 25 years of experience teaching grades 3–5. A thought leader in education, Rayna embraces challenges and leads with curiosity, reflection, and a growth mindset. She is passionate about building community, cultivating the voices of others, and driving learning through authentic advocacy. Rayna serves as a curriculum and technology leader in her district and holds leadership roles within her local educators' union, MassCUE, and the Massachusetts Department of Education. A frequent presenter at national and international conferences, she recently led a district team in rewriting vision, mission, and core values. Rayna believes meaningful change happens through relationships, collaboration, and courageous leadership.

Kimberly Zajac— Kim is a speech language pathologist and audiologist who is passionate about providing equitable access and inclusion for all learners. With 30 years of cross-industry professional and non-profit leadership experience, Kim serves as an architect of access for innovative integration of design thinking and technology to create transformational teaching, learning, and life experiences. She partners with families and schools to create practical supports, blending therapy, technology, and collaboration so students can better understand, participate, and feel confident in classrooms and everyday life. Kim is a 2026 Tech & Learning Innovative Leader Award recipient, an ISTE ASCD Community Leader, a K12 Leaders Advisory Board Member, a Vital Prize Challenge Educator Mentor, a LeveragED Collective Member, a FETC Featured Speaker, and a recognized 2024 ASU+GSV AIRShow AI Classroom Innovator. Kim is a member of the MA DESE AI Task Force as well as the Norton Public Schools AI Task Force. Kim presents conferences and contributes in circles of thought partnership at the national level.
